Brandywine Tomato Flower. The ‘brandywine’ tomato family, has something for everyone. The plant can reach up to 1.8 m (6 feet). Lycopersicon lycopersicum ‘brandywine’) is one of the most popular varieties of heirloom. It has the wide, bulging shape of beefsteak tomatoes with a slightly pointed tip at the blossom end of the fruit. Many color options are also available in the brandywine family, including red brandywine, pink brandywine, orange, yellow brandywine and even black brandywine tomatoes. These tomatoes are known for their robust flavor and thick, juicy flesh. Read on for the best ‘brandywine’ tomato varieties and some top tips on. The brandywine varieties are some of the most popular heirloom tomatoes grown in north america. Each variety has a unique taste, size, shape and colour. Brandywine tomatoes are large, heirloom varieties that grow to about 10 cm (4 inches) in diameter and can weigh up to 0.5 kg (1 pound).
